I have always wanted to visit Sudan ever since I read "The Blue Nile" and "The White Nile" and to have actually been in Khartoum and have a boat trip to the confluence was fascinating, and of course to visit the famous Omdurman. What a history Sudan has.
We also loved visiting the Sixth Cataract of the Nile in such a beautiful green and mountainous setting, not to mention spending time at the temple complexes of Naqa and Musawarat. These sites were made even more special by being off-road and having them to ourselves.
In our four days in Sudan we had three spectacular sunsets - two on the Nile and the third one at the pyramids of Meroe. It was a magical experience - sitting on a sand-dune each, quiet, spiritual with nobody else around to spoil the atmosphere.
It is such a shame that most people associate Sudan with tragedy and suffering and therefore do not consider the country as a place to visit.
This is not to deny that it very unfortunately DOES exist in certain areas, and the horror of it is all one ever hears about in the media.
